Terms in this set (137)


A space that:
-is large enough to enter and work.
Confined Space
-has limited or restricted means for entry.
-is not designed for continuous occupancy.

An employer's written authorization to perform work
Hot Work Permit
capable of providing a source of ignition.

A form of purging or ventilating a confined space
where an inert gas (such as nitrogen, carbon dioxide
or argon) is used to displace the atmosphere in a
Inerting
confined space to remove fire or explosion hazards.
Causes oxygen levels to become unstable for re-
entry.

19.5% to 23.5%
Oxygen Safe Zone Below 19.5=unsafe for breathing
Above 23.5=explosive

The part or area of a drawing to which a number, note
Leader Line or other reference applies. They are solid lines and
usually terminate in a single arrowhead.

Hydraulic Term: A construction in the bore of the pipe which requires
"Resistance" more pressure to pass the same amount of water.

, Hydraulic Term: Electric potential is equivalent to pressure and the
"Voltage" voltage (or voltage drop/potential difference) is the
(Assume water is flowing difference in pressure between two points.
horizontally so gravity isn't
a factor)

Hydraulic Term: Equivalent to a hydraulic volume flow rate; that is the
"Current" volumetric quantity of flowing water over time.

Current through a conductor between two points is
Ohm's Law directly proportional to the voltage across the two
points.

S.O.P. Standard operating procedure.

N.E.C. National Electrical Code.

N.F.P.A. National Fire Protection Association

NPT National pipe thread. Tapered pipe.

Displays negative AND positive pressure
Compound Gauge
measurements

Cat1 Meter Measures electronics

Cat2 Meter Measures single-phase receptacles.

Measures 3 phase distribution and single phase
Cat3 Meter
lighting equipment.

Measures 3 phase at utility connection and any
Cat4 Meter
outdoor connections.

L.O.T.O. Lock out tag out is an osha regulation.

3 elements needed to Heat, oxygen and fuel.
start a fire.

Class C fire. Electrical fire

What is Rust Combination of water, oxygen and iron.
